Extreme GPU Bruteforcer 1.0 is meant for the recovery of passwords from hashes of different types, utilizing the power of GPU, which enables reaching truly extreme attack speed. For example, the search speed for MD5 hashes with GeForce 8800GS reaches 250…270 million passwords per second.
The program uses the exhaustive search attack, supports MD5 and MySQL hashing algorithms, does not require installation and has a very light size.

Cain & Abel is a password recovery tool for Microsoft Operating Systems. It allows easy recovery of various kind of passwords by sniffing the network, cracking encrypted passwords using Dictionary, Brute-Force and Cryptanalysis attacks, recording VoIP conversations, decoding scrambled passwords, revealing password boxes, uncovering cached passwords and analyzing routing protocols.
The program does not exploit any software vulnerabilities or bugs that could not be fixed with little effort. It covers some security aspects/weakness present in protocol´s standards, authentication methods and caching mechanisms; its main purpose is the simplified recovery of passwords and credentials from various sources, however it also ships some “non standard” utilities for Microsoft Windows users.
SAMInside is designated for the recovery of Windows NT/2000/XP/2003/Vista user passwords.
Some of its outstanding features include:
• The program has small footprint, it doesn’t require the installation and can be run from a diskette, CD/DVD-disk or USB-drive.
• Includes over 10 types of data import and 6 types of password attack:
– Brute-force attack
– Distributed attack
– Mask attack
– Dictionary attack
– Hybrid attack
– Pre-calculated tables attack• Top-speed performance on any CPU, since the recovery code completely written in Assembler.
• The application understands national character sets and properly displays non-latin Windows NT/2000/XP/2003/Vista user names and passwords.

PasswordsPro 2.4.3.0 is designated for the recovery of passwords for different types of hashes. The program currently supports about 30 types of hashes, and new ones can be easily added by creating a custom external hashing DLL-module. The actual list of available modules can be found on the software-related forum. The peak number of hashes the application is capable of working with simultaneously is 256.

PstPassword is a small utility that recovers lost password of Outlook .PST (Personal Folders) file.
This utility can recover the PST passwords of Outlook 97, Outlook 2000, Outlook XP, Outlook 2003, and Outlook 2007. You don´t have to install MS-Outlook in order to use this utility. You only need the original PST file that you locked with a password.

Active@ Password Changer is designed for resetting local administrator and user passwords on Windows XP / VISTA / 2003 / 2000 / NT systems in case an Administrator’s password is forgotten or lost. You do not need to re-install and re-configure the operating system.
Forgotten password recovery software has a simple user interface, supports multiple hard disk drives, detects several SAM databases (if multiple OS were installed on one volume) and provides the opportunity to pick the right SAM before starting the password recovery process. It displays a list of all local users. The software user simply chooses the local user from the list to reset the password.
